Genesis 41:51-52
New American Standard Bible
51 Joseph named the firstborn [a]Manasseh; “For,” he said, “God has made me forget all my trouble and all of my father’s household.” 52 And he named the second [b]Ephraim; “For,” he said, “(A)God has made me fruitful in the land of my affliction.”
Read full chapterFootnotes
- Genesis 41:51 I.e., making to forget
- Genesis 41:52 I.e., fruitfulness

Joshua 14:4
New American Standard Bible
4 For the sons of Joseph were two tribes, (A)Manasseh and Ephraim, and they did not give a portion to the Levites in the land, except cities to live in, with their pasture lands for their livestock and for their property.
